The Meinl Artisan Edition 12-inch Djembe represents a sophisticated bridge between traditional West African soul and modern manufacturing precision. While many mass-produced djembes can feel sterile, the one-piece Siam Oak shell here offers a surprisingly organic resonance. The CNC-carved interior promotes a focused airflow, resulting in a bass note that feels physically impactful without the muddy overtones often found in cheaper stave-constructed shells.

The goatskin head is the standout feature; it is selected with enough thickness to withstand high-tension 'Mali-weave' tuning while remaining sensitive enough for delicate ghost notes. You get those piercing, glass-shattering slaps that define the genre, beautifully contrasted by a warm, woody mid-tone. However, the traditional rope tuning system"while authentic"requires a learning curve and significant hand strength that players accustomed to mechanical lug-tuned drums might find tedious.

Compared to boutique African imports, this model offers superior structural consistency and a more refined rim contour that is significantly kinder to the palms during high-volume sessions. It is an ideal choice for the serious intermediate percussionist or ensemble player who needs a reliable, stage-ready instrument that won't warp under humidity changes. While it sits at a premium price point for an oak drum, the tonal clarity and professional 'pop' justify the investment for those moving beyond entry-level fiberglass models.
